A Grammys producer has responded to Bianca Censori‘s shocking see-through dress, insisting that it did “adhere to standards”.

Kanye West and his wife got the whole world talking as they made a statement on the red carpet of the Grammy Awards.

The couple arrived at the lavish music event and posed for the cameras when Bianca dropped her fur coat to reveal that she was wearing nothing underneath but a totally sheer dress and no under garments.

Rumours began to swirl that the couple were removed from the event by furious bosses and reports began to circulate that the pair could be reprimanded by police after the indecent exposure.

However, now following the stunt, an executive producer behind the 2025 Grammy Awards has explained the dress code for the event.

Raj Kapoor said that invites to the event suggest the dress code is “artistic black tie”. However, he admitted: “But in the music industry, I guess that’s up for interpretation.”

He told People: “Obviously there is a dress code for anybody actually performing on the show that we have to adhere to standards and practices.

“But as far as people attending and nominees attending, that would be something the [Recording] Academy [presents the Grammys] would have to answer.”

The stunt certainly got tongues wagging but many think that Bianca’s outfit is a nod to the cover of Kanye’s 2024 album, Vultures. In an update, Kayne posted a photo of the dress and simply said: “The invisible dress”.

He then posted: “For clarity February 4th 2025 My wife is the most Googled person on the planet called Earth.”

Despite many thinking that there may be repercussions for their red carpet look, the Los Angeles Police Department informed TMZ on Monday that no formal complaints were made by anyone present at the Crypto.com Arena on Sunday evening.

The sources also highlighted that the annual awards show is a private event.

“While Ms. Censori’s outfit undoubtedly pushed the envelope, a charge of indecent exposure in California requires willful public exposure of one’s genitals with the specific intent to offend or sexually arouse,” LA-based lawyer Andrea Oguntula has told Page Six.

“It’s theoretically possible but unlikely she’ll face any criminal prosecution for this incident,” Oguntula added, noting it is down to the district attorney’s office to make that decision.
